The Offer:
- A full-time, permanent position with 38 hours 15 minutes per week working time
- A basic monthly, full-time salary of a care assistant ( 2 167€/month before taxes & social contributions) prior to reaching your licenced status and when taking part in your apprentice ship training program in Finland.
- After receiving your license to practice as a practical/help nurse in Finland, a basic monthly salary starting from 2433,97 €/ month before taxes & social constibutions.
- Additional compensation for inconvenient working hours (evenings, weekends, nights, holidays, alarm shifts, planned overtime & overtime) and vacation time which are paid on top of the basic monthly salary if and when applicable.
- Minimum 23 days per year starting after the first full working year acting as basis for calculations. Previous accepted work experience will add vacation days in accordance to experience years.
- Free Language training before you relocate
- Education alongside your work for you to be licensed as a practical nurse in Finland after your arrival
- Induction to your new tasks and responsibilities when you start working
- Home finding & relocation assistance
- Work related healthcare plan and work related insurances
- Unemployment and retirement plans & benefits
We expect you to:
- Have a license to practice your profession within the field of nursing as an assistant nurse, and this license to be granted to you by European Union country officials.
- Have preferably three (3) years of experience practicing your profession after finalizing your studies.
- Commit to a free-of-charge language training program, and to study a minimum 20 hrs per week in order to reach a B1 level of Finnish language at the end of the training
- Commit to a free-of-charge apprenticeship program after arrival in Finland, interlinked in with paid working contract in order to receive a Finnish diploma as a practical nurse, giving opportunities to further educate to become as a registered nurse later on.
